Looking for a picturesque getaway? Spend a memorable weekend in Lansdowne, a serene hill station in the Garhwal region of Uttarakhand, India. Surrounded by lush greenery and panoramic views of the Himalayas, Lansdowne offers a perfect retreat for nature lovers and adventure enthusiasts alike. Here's a detailed itinerary for your 2-day trip.
Begin your day with a visit to Bhulla Tal, a tranquil lake surrounded by tall pine trees. Enjoy a leisurely walk along the lakeside and soak in the serene ambiance. Afterward, you can head to Tip-n-Top viewpoint, which offers breathtaking views of the snow-capped peaks of the Himalayas. In the afternoon, visit St. Mary's Church, a beautiful British-era church known for its architecture and peaceful surroundings. In the evening, take a stroll on the Mall Road and indulge in some local shopping.
Start your morning with a thrilling adventure at the Zip-Line Adventure Park. Zipline through the scenic landscapes and experience an adrenaline rush like never before. Afterward, head to the Garhwali Mess, a local eatery famous for its authentic Garhwali cuisine. Savor the flavors of the region and enjoy a hearty meal. In the afternoon, visit the War Memorial, dedicated to the soldiers of Garhwal Rifles. Finally, end your trip with a nature walk in the Kalagarh Tiger Reserve, where you can spot various flora and fauna.
If you have some extra time, don't miss visiting Kanvashram, a tranquil ashram located on the banks of river Malini. It is believed to be the place where Shakuntala, the mother of Emperor Bharata, resided. Another place worth exploring is Bhim Pakora, a unique natural rock formation that consists of two balancing rocks. Locals also recommend trying local delicacies like Bal Mithai and Masala Tea for a truly authentic taste of Lansdowne.
